MEES 2031

EPC B minimum standard

Buildings over 1,000 sq m must reach EPC B by 2031, per the UK government's June 2026 update. Non-compliant buildings become unlettable.

Heating monitoring that matches how your building actually works.

IF YOU'RE ON A DISTRICT NETWORK

You receive heat from an external network via an ETS, billed like a utility in kWh. Flutegrid shows capacity usage, efficiency, and automatically verifies the bill against the meter.

IF YOU RUN YOUR OWN PLANT ROOM

Your building has its own boiler, CHP, or heat pump — there's no external heat bill. Flutegrid shows plant efficiency, so a failing or inefficient plant gets caught before it costs you a season.
